6.5.2 Simulated Anterior Keratometry (SimK), standard
topography (7.5 mm diameter)
Reported in-vivo repeatabilities are based on N=32 eyes, including 9 eyes with
irregular corneal shape. In-vivo repeatability is calculated as the standard deviation
of pairwise differences of three repeated measurements per eye for all eyes.
Measurement range SimK:
32.1 - 67.5 dpt
Display resolution SimK:
0.01 dpt
In vivo repeatability SimK
mean
(1. SD):
± 0.22 dpt
In vivo repeatability SimAST (1. SD):
± 0.18 dpt
Measurement range SimAxis:
0 - 180°
Display resolution SimAxis:
1°
In vivo repeatability SimAxis, 0.5 dpt < AST ≤ 1.5 dpt (1. SD): ± 3.7°
In vivo repeatability SimAxis, AST > 1.5 dpt (1. SD):
± 2.1°
Display resolution Corneal Shape Factor:
0.01
In vivo repeatability Corneal Shape Factor:
0.07
6.5.3 Simulated Posterior Keratometry (SimPK), standard
topography (7.5 mm diameter)
Reported in-vivo repeatabilities are based on N=31 eyes, including 8 eyes with
irregular corneal shape. In-vivo repeatability is calculated as the standard deviation
of pairwise differences of three repeated measurements per eye for all eyes.
Measurement range SimPK:
3.9 - 9.5 dpt
Display resolution SimPK:
0.01 dpt
In vivo repeatability SimPK
mean
(1. SD):
± 0.032 dpt
In vivo repeatability SimPAST (1. SD):
± 0.029 dpt
Measurement range SimPAxis:
0 - 180°
Display resolution SimPAxis:
1°
In vivo repeatability SimPAxis, SimPAST > 0.5 dpt (1. SD):
no occurrences
Display resolution Posterior Corneal Shape Factor:
0.01
In vivo repeatability Posterior Corneal Shape Factor:
0.09
